  1. The storage modulus is described by a line of the form E' = A log e (f) + B, where f represents frequency. SE is the standard error of the coefficients A and B. R 2 is a squared correlation coefficient and shows how well the line fits the data points. If p < 0.05 it indicates that the line is statistically significant. Loss modulus and phase angle results given as mean and standard deviation (SD).
